Hong Kong's imports of goods in

1984 totalled

HK$223,370

million

(approx.

£22,337

million), an

increase of 27% over 1983. The principal

imports were:

Manufactured goods

28.6%

Machinery and Transport equipment

25.8%

Consumer Goods

18.1%

Food Stuffs

9.0%

Chemicals and related products

6.9%

Fuels

5.5%

The principal suppliers were:

China

25.0%

Japan

23.6%

United States

10.9%

Taiwan

7.8%

Singapore

5.5%

UK

3.9%

Republic of Korea (South Korea)

3.3%
